Richmond Code Camp, Entity Framework and the Beer House

I will be presenting an introduction to the Entity Framework and the Beer House this Saturday at the Richmond Code Camp. I have been very busy with the Beer House application, Entity Framework, ASP.NET AJAX, CSS Layouts and much more the past 2 months and it will be wonderful to get out a little and share what I have learned.

This presentation will have maybe 4 slides in a slide deck and will be pretty much nothing but rolling up my sleeves and showing how to build an n-Tiered app using the Entity Framework as the Data Access Layer and the Repository Pattern. Be forewarned there will be no EntityDataSource in this presentation!

My goals are to show you how to get up and running using the Entity Framework, a good n-Tiered architecture and a web site. This will just touch the tip of the ice berg and I hope it wets your appetite to look more into the use of the Entity Framework as a data access option.

Kevin Hazzard has posted a list of all the Richmond Code Camp speakers and kudos to him for organizing the speakers! If you are in the area of Richmond I hope to see you there this Saturday.
